Day 352: As I am scrolling through Facebook I am enjoying reading all the motivational sayings that come with the new year. I am also scrolling through people’s New Year’s resolutions which causes me to reflect back to this time one year ago when I submitted my application for the year of you. I remember it like it was yesterday and am blown away that it has been a year, but I remember sitting in bed writing the email saying why I wanted to be chosen. High blood pressure, sleep apnea, overweight....I remember debating whether or not I should hit the send button. It was close to midnight and the application was due. Should I risk pushing the button? It was a serious debate as I wasn’t sure I wanted to expose my normally quiet and reserved self. At that moment though I remembered the old saying, “if you keep doing what you’ve been doing you’ll keep getting the same result.” I pushed the button.
